Market Size for Refractory Bricks, Blocks and Tiles in Singapore
The Singaporean market for refractory bricks, blocks and tiles shrank notably to $X in 2021, declining by -29.9% against the previous year. This figure reflects the total revenues of producers and importers (excluding logistics costs, retail marketing costs, and retailers' margins, which will be included in the final consumer price). Over the period under review, consumption showed a slight curtailment. Over the period under review, the market attained the maximum level at $X in 2018; however, from 2019 to 2021, consumption failed to regain momentum.

Exports by Country
Indonesia (X tons) was the main destination for refractory bricks, blocks and tiles exports from Singapore, accounting for a 87% share of total exports. Moreover, refractory bricks, blocks and tiles exports to Indonesia exceeded the volume sent to the second major destination, China (X tons), ninefold.
From 2012 to 2021, the average annual rate of growth in terms of volume to Indonesia stood at -3.9%. Exports to the other major destinations recorded the following average annual rates of exports growth: China (+34.3% per year) and Malaysia (-4.2% per year).
In value terms, Indonesia ($X) remains the key foreign market for refractory bricks, blocks and tiles exports from Singapore, comprising 82% of total exports. The second position in the ranking was held by China ($X), with a 10% share of total exports.
From 2012 to 2021, the average annual growth rate of value to Indonesia stood at -5.5%. Exports to the other major destinations recorded the following average annual rates of exports growth: China (+75.0% per year) and Malaysia (-1.6% per year).

Imports by Country
China (X tons), Poland (X tons) and India (X tons) were the main suppliers of refractory bricks, blocks and tiles imports to Singapore, together accounting for 73% of total imports. Turkey, the Netherlands, Japan, Germany and Thailand l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 23%.
From 2012 to 2021, the biggest increases were recorded for Turkey (with a CAGR of +78.7%), while purchases for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.
In value terms, Poland ($X), China ($X) and Germany ($X) were the largest refractory bricks, blocks and tiles suppliers to Singapore, with a combined 60% share of total imports. These countries were followed by Turkey, Japan, India, the Netherlands and Thailand, which together accounted for a further 31%.
Among the main suppliers, Turkey, with a CAGR of +81.7%, saw the highest growth rate of the value of imports, over the period under review, while purchases for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.
